Study Endpoints

Primary Endpoints

Percentage of Participants Achieving a 50 Percent (%) Reduction From Baseline in Eczema Area and Severity Index (EASI) Score (EASI-50) at Week 12
Week 12

Secondary Endpoints

Percent Change From Baseline in EASI Score at Week 12
Baseline, Week 12
Absolute Change From Baseline in EASI Score at Week 12
Baseline, Week 12
Percentage of Participants Achieving a 75% Reduction From Baseline in EASI Score (EASI-75) at Week 12
Week 12

Treatment Arms

ArmTypeDescription
Lebrikizumab 250 mg Single Dose + TCS CreamEXPERIMENTALParticipants will receive lebrikizumab 250 milligrams (mg) SC single dose on Day 1 followed by placebo on Week 4 and Week 8. Participants will continue to apply TCS cream (triamcenolone acetonide 0.1% or hydrocortisone 2.5% cream) twice daily to active skin lesions throughout the 12-week treatment period.
Lebrikizumab 125 mg Single Dose + TCS CreamEXPERIMENTALParticipants will receive lebrikizumab 125 mg SC single dose on Day 1 followed by placebo on Week 4 and Week 8. Participants will continue to apply TCS cream (triamcenolone acetonide 0.1% or hydrocortisone 2.5% cream) twice daily to active skin lesions throughout the 12-week treatment period.
Lebrikizumab 125 mg Q4W + TCS CreamEXPERIMENTALParticipants will receive lebrikizumab 125 mg SC every 4 weeks (Q4W) for a total of 3 doses. Participants will continue to apply TCS cream (triamcenolone acetonide 0.1% or hydrocortisone 2.5% cream) twice daily to active skin lesions throughout the 12-week treatment period.
Placebo Q4W + TCS CreamPLACEBO_COMPARATORParticipants will receive placebo Q4W for a total of 3 doses. Participants will continue to apply TCS cream (triamcenolone acetonide 0.1% or hydrocortisone 2.5% cream) twice daily to active skin lesions throughout the 12-week treatment period.

Interventions

NameTypeDescription
LebrikizumabDRUGLebrikizumab will be administered SC as per the schedule specified in the respective arms.
PlaceboDRUGPlacebo matching to lebrikizumab will be administered as per the schedule specified in the respective arms.
TCS CreamDRUGTCS cream (triamcenolone acetonide 0.1% or hydrocortisone 2.5% cream) twice daily
